An abortion is a clinical treatment to finish a pregnancy expanding in the womb (womb). It's in some cases called a caused abortion. An approximated 1 in 4 females in the U.S. will have an abortion throughout their life time. In 2023, there had to do with 1 million abortions in the U.S., up 20% from 2020. There are two primary kinds of abortions: clinical and surgical.With a medical abortion, a doctor does a treatment in a medical office, facility, or medical facility. Nearly all abortions are outpatient, which suggests you won't need to stay over night in a clinical facility. The sort of abortion you get will certainly depend upon several things, including your health and just how far along you remain in your pregnancy.

Considering That the High court overturned the Roe v. Wade choice that legislated abortion across the country, numerous states have outlawed or restricted abortion. State abortion legislations may change usually because of court obstacles and legislative efforts. Both primary abortion methods are medical, which utilizes medicines, and medical, which involves a procedure done by a healthcare company.
You might be called for to get therapy in person or to have a physician with you when you take the very first dose of medicine. Many states require you to wait a particular amount of time after the counseling session up until you get an abortion, although there's no medical reason for this.

As a matter of fact, it's safe than providing birth. It includes little threats, like any medical procedure does, though it's very unusual for abortion to cause serious problems. Possible problems include: An insufficient abortion - St Louis women's healthcare. This is most likely with a drug abortion. You'll require more medication or a treatment. Infection. Your medical professional can prescribe antibiotics to remove it up.
